Objective 28 is substitution method (real solutions)
There is two ways to do this objective, there is pen and paper method and using graphmatica. Im going to show you how to do both of them...
Here is the pen and paper method....
Question: 2x+y=60
3x+2y=104
L1= 2x+y=60
L2= 3x+2y=104
Step 1: Choose the varible with a coefficient of 1, or solve for a single varible in either equation (in this case its the "y")
Step 2: Use transitive property to substitude into the other eqution
So it then becomes: L1= Y=(60-2x)
L2= 3x+2(60-2x)=104
Step 3: Solve for the non- chosen varible
So 3x+2(60-2x)=104
3x+120-4x=104
x=16
Step 4: SUBSTITUTE & SOLVE for the original varible
Since 2x+y=60
and 2(16)+y=60
Since 32+y=60
y=28 x=16
Step 5: CHECK a) Substitute in mental math or calculator
b) Look at the pic using technology
x=16 and y=28
